More good news on IJNT - even more to come: IJNT.net Agrees to Develop and Host New E-Commerce Website; Troublewear.com Will Market Branded Apparel and Accessories to Teens, Age 12 to 21 Business Wire - May 04, 1999 09:31 HOUSTON--(BUSINESS WIRE)--May 4, 1999--IJNT.net (OTC BB:IJNT), a leading wireless and high-speed Internet access provider, today announced that it has agreed in principle to develop and host a new website for Troublewear.com, a new company in which IJNT will hold an equity interest. Troublewear.com will sell a branded line of lifestyle apparel and accessories, targeted primarily to teen males aged 12 to 21, exclusively on the Internet through the IJNT developed site, Troublewear.com. The Company expects the new website to begin operating in July 1999. Greg Matsen, division head of Man Rabbit House Multimedia Website Services, the IJNT subsidiary that develops and manages e-commerce websites, said that the Troublewear concept's main strength stems from the successful record of the company's six founding managers. "This management team is terrific," Matsen said. "They have more than one hundred years combined experience in brand and apparel marketing and management, including senior management experience with such companies as Mossimo, Gotcha International, Quicksilver, Fila, Gap, Lucky Jeans, Levi's, and Calvin Klein." Matsen added that the Troublewear.com management also had marketing experience with the National Football League, Major League Baseball, Time-Warner, Harley Davidson, and Budweiser, among others. "Our management team knows this market, which is a growing $13 billion per year industry in the U.S. alone," said Don Kerkes, president of Troublewear.com. "Our primary targets, teenage males, are the heaviest Internet users and, according to Jupiter Communications, apparel sales will be the number one Internet growth category over the next several years."
